In 2025, the landscape of low-code and no-code platforms continues to evolve, with Retool and Bubble standing out as two popular options. Retool is designed primarily for developers looking to build internal tools quickly and efficiently, while Bubble caters to non-technical users who want to create public-facing applications without writing code. This article provides a concise comparison of both platforms to help you determine which one is best suited for your next project.
Retool is a low-code platform that focuses on building internal tools using various components such as tables, charts, and forms. It integrates seamlessly with databases and APIs, making it an excellent choice for developers. In contrast, Bubble is a comprehensive no-code web app builder that allows users to create applications, SaaS platforms, and marketplaces without any coding knowledge. Understanding the core functionalities of each platform is essential for making an informed decision.
When comparing features, Retool excels in backend development, making it ideal for dashboards, admin panels, and CRUD applications. It offers a drag-and-drop user interface builder with strong data binding capabilities and supports various data sources, including SQL, REST, GraphQL, and Firebase. On the other hand, Bubble provides both front-end and back-end capabilities, featuring a powerful visual editor with responsive design options, built-in database workflows, and user authentication. Its extensive plugin marketplace and third-party integrations further enhance its functionality.
Retool's advantages include its speed in building internal applications, secure enterprise-ready infrastructure, and ease of connection with existing databases or APIs. However, it is not ideal for public-facing applications, has limited design customization, and requires some coding knowledge. Conversely, Bubble offers a 100% no-code experience, making it accessible for non-tech founders, along with a highly customizable user interface and built-in database logic. Its downsides include a steep learning curve and potential performance issues in complex applications, as well as challenges related to vendor lock-in and scaling.
In terms of pricing, Retool offers a free plan for individuals, with paid plans starting at $12 per month per user. Bubble also has a free tier, with paid plans beginning around $29 per month, including scaling options. Use cases for Bubble include marketplaces, booking applications, and social networks, while Retool is well-suited for internal CRM systems, admin dashboards, and reporting tools. Understanding the pricing structure and potential use cases can help you choose the right platform for your needs.
In conclusion, Retool is best suited for internal, data-heavy tools that require quick development cycles, while Bubble is ideal for creating full-featured applications without any coding. Your choice between these platforms should be guided by your project's goals, your skill set, and the needs of your end users. By evaluating these factors, you can select the platform that aligns best with your objectives in 2025.
Q: What is Retool designed for?
A: Retool is designed primarily for developers looking to build internal tools quickly and efficiently.
Q: Who is Bubble intended for?
A: Bubble caters to non-technical users who want to create public-facing applications without writing code.
Q: What are the core functionalities of Retool?
A: Retool focuses on building internal tools using components such as tables, charts, and forms, and integrates seamlessly with databases and APIs.
Q: What capabilities does Bubble offer?
A: Bubble is a comprehensive no-code web app builder that allows users to create applications, SaaS platforms, and marketplaces without any coding knowledge.
Q: What are the strengths of Retool?
A: Retool excels in backend development, making it ideal for dashboards, admin panels, and CRUD applications, with strong data binding capabilities.
Q: What features does Bubble provide?
A: Bubble offers both front-end and back-end capabilities, a powerful visual editor, built-in database workflows, user authentication, and an extensive plugin marketplace.
Q: What are the pros of using Retool?
A: Retool's advantages include speed in building internal applications, secure infrastructure, and ease of connection with existing databases or APIs.
Q: What are the cons of using Bubble?
A: Bubble's downsides include a steep learning curve, potential performance issues in complex applications, and challenges related to vendor lock-in and scaling.
Q: What is the pricing structure for Retool?
A: Retool offers a free plan for individuals, with paid plans starting at $12 per month per user.
Q: What use cases are suitable for Bubble?
A: Use cases for Bubble include marketplaces, booking applications, and social networks.
Q: What should guide your choice between Retool and Bubble?
A: Your choice should be guided by your project's goals, your skill set, and the needs of your end users.